The basic parts of a mortared-stone wall. Components can vary for other types of retaining walls. Drainage stone: Keeps water from collecting behind the wall Filter fabric: Prevents soil from clogging drainage stone Batter: The backward lean into the earth, about 1 inch for every 1 foot of wall height Weep hole: Spaced every 6 to 8 feet, it lets water drain through …The original color of the White House was white. That is, an option is what you will not ...Tips for Repairing a Retaining Wall. Keep the retaining wall blocks clean on top and on bottom for a better fit. Add 4-inch perforated drain tube to the base of the backfill for improved drainage. Replacement retaining wall blocks can be difficult to match, even when the sizes appear to be the same. Take a block with …Lay the Base Blocks. Start laying blocks at one end, using a full block. Use a torpedo level to check the level front to back. Tap the blocks with a rubber mallet until they are level with one another. If you need to raise a block, put sand or base material under it. Level every block on the first course. Step 5: Install the Capstones. Capstones add the finishing touch to your dry-stack stone retaining wall. Save your flattest and nicest-looking stones to use as capstones to give your wall a clean, finished look. Level your final course of stone as much as possible before you add the capstones. Apply additional layers of stone one at a time, fitting stones together to reduce gap sizes to between 1/2 and 1 inch wide. Fill gaps with soil and smaller gravel, apply a thin top layer and compact the soil before applying the next layer.
